Информация

Что такое SEQ в Питоне

В Python последовательности (sequences) — это итерируемые объекты, к элементам которых можно обратиться по целочисленному индексу, а также узнать их количество (длину последовательности). Среди примеров таких объектов: list, tuple и str (все они являются последовательностями), а также функции-генераторы, файловые объекты, объекты zip, iter, map и др.

  1. Особенности последовательностей
  2. Преобразование данных в строку с помощью STR
  3. Задание разделителя с помощью SEP
  4. Завершение программы в Python
  5. Конкатенация строк в Python
  6. Полезные советы
  7. Выводы

Особенности последовательностей

Ключевая особенность последовательностей — доступ к элементам объекта по индексу. Однако такой индекс может быть не только численным, но также и строковым, а иногда даже иным типом. Другой важный признак — итерируемость, благодаря которой можно перебрать все элементы объекта в цикле.

Преобразование данных в строку с помощью STR

В Python функция str используется для преобразования данных в строку. Эту функцию можно применить к любому типу данных, чтобы получить его строковое представление. Например, если ввести str(34), то функция вернет строку '34', а если str([1, 2, 3]), то вернет строку '[1, 2, 3]'.

Задание разделителя с помощью SEP

Когда нам нужно вывести несколько элементов через пробел, мы используем функцию print(). Однако, по умолчанию между элементами ставится пробел. Чтобы заменить его на другой символ, можно использовать функцию sep. Она позволяет задать любой другой разделитель, например, запятую или точку с запятой.

Завершение программы в Python

Для завершения программы в Python существует несколько способов. Один из них — использование функции exit(). Однако, лучше использовать ее для выхода из интерактивного интерпретатора Python. Если же нужно завершить выполнение всех частей программы, следует использовать функцию sys.exit().

Конкатенация строк в Python

Конкатенация (склеивание) строк в Python — это операция, при которой две или более строк соединяются в одну. Результатом этой операции является новая строка, содержащая все символы из исходных. Для выполнения операции конкатенации можно использовать оператор «+», а также методы join() и concatenate().

Полезные советы

  • Проверяйте тип данных итерируемых объектов перед их обработкой, чтобы предотвратить возникновение ошибок.
  • Если нужно склеивать большое количество строк, лучше не использовать оператор «+», а использовать метод join() или concatenate().
  • При выводе на консоль не стесняйтесь использовать метод format() для форматирования строк. Это поможет улучшить читаемость и обеспечить правильное отображение данных.
  • Если вы используете функцию print(), всегда указывайте символ конца строки («\n»), чтобы не забывать переводить курсор на следующую строку.
  • Если вы работаете с файлами, не забывайте закрывать их после окончания работы.

Выводы

Наличие в Python различных последовательностей, таких как списки, кортежи и строки, позволяет удобно работать с итерируемыми объектами. Функции str и sep упрощают работу с строковыми данными и выводом на экран, а методы конкатенации предоставляют множество вариантов соединения строк. Для завершения программы в Python можно использовать функцию exit() или sys.exit(). Выполняя рекомендации в полезных советах, можно обеспечить более эффективную и продуктивную работу в Python.

Можно ли летать месячному ребенку
^